Prep Ahead for Quick Wrap Assembly

Prepping ingredients in advance is key to speedy wrap assembly. Dedicate a few minutes on the weekend or before you start cooking to chop vegetables, cook proteins, and mix sauces. Store these components in the fridge, ready to be combined when hunger strikes.

Consider using a meal prep container with compartments to keep ingredients organized and easily accessible. This method also allows you to portion out your fillings, ensuring balanced meals and minimal food waste.

Master the Art of Multitasking

While your wraps are cooking or heating, use this time to prepare other components. For instance, while the chicken is grilling, you can chop salad greens, slice avocado, or mix a quick dressing. This efficient use of time ensures that your wrap is ready to eat as soon as the last component is heated or assembled.

Additionally, consider using kitchen gadgets like a food processor to speed up prep work. For example, you can quickly chop vegetables or create a flavorful hummus or tzatziki sauce with just a few pulses.

Variety is the Spice of Life: Exploring Fillings

One of the joys of wraps is their endless possibilities. From classic combinations to creative concoctions, there's a filling for every taste bud. Here are some ideas to inspire your next wrap creation:

1. Protein-packed: Grilled chicken, steak, or tofu; black beans, chickpeas, or lentils; or smoked salmon and eggs.

2. Veggie-loaded: Spinach, kale, or mixed greens; bell peppers, cucumbers, and tomatoes; or roasted vegetables like zucchini, eggplant, or sweet potatoes.

3. Cheesy and creamy: Feta, mozzarella, or cheddar cheese; avocado or guacamole; or cream cheese or Greek yogurt-based sauces.

4. Flavorful sauces and dressings: Hummus, pesto, or aioli; salsa, chimichurri, or BBQ sauce; or vinaigrettes, ranch, or tahini dressing.

Classic Wrap Combinations

While it's fun to experiment with new flavors, sometimes a tried-and-true classic is just what you need. Here are some popular wrap combinations to get you started:

  • Chicken Caesar Wrap: Grilled chicken, romaine lettuce, Caesar dressing, Parmesan cheese, and croutons.
  • Mediterranean Wrap: Grilled chicken or falafel, mixed greens, cucumber, tomato, red onion, feta cheese, and tzatziki sauce.
  • BBQ Pulled Pork Wrap: Slow-cooked pulled pork, BBQ sauce, coleslaw, and pickles.
  • Veggie and Hummus Wrap: Hummus, mixed greens, sliced bell peppers, cucumber, tomato, red onion, and feta cheese.

Get Creative with Your Wraps

Don't be afraid to think outside the box when it comes to wrap fillings. Consider global flavors, unique ingredient pairings, or even leftover makeovers. Here are a few ideas to spark your creativity:

1. Breakfast for dinner: Scrambled eggs, bacon, and cheese; or smoked salmon, cream cheese, and capers.

2. Global cuisine: Korean bulgogi with kimchi slaw; Indian-spiced chickpeas with raita; or Mexican-inspired steak with guacamole and pico de gallo.

3. Leftover makeover: Transform last night's roast chicken into a chicken and vegetable wrap; or use leftover chili or stew as a hearty filling.
